## Features

A collection of NodeJS snippets

The following commands are available:

- `node-express`, creates an express server
- `node-express-get`, creates GET route
- `node-express-get-params`, creates a GET route and shows how to access parameters
- `node-express-post`, creates a POST route
- `node-express-post-params`, creates a POST route and shows how to access the body
- `node-express-post-params-alt`, creates a POST route, shows how to access the body, works for express 4.16 and above
- `node-express-put-params`, creates a PUT route, shows how to access body.
- `node-express-delete-params`, creates a DELETE route, shows how to access route parameter.
- `node-express-query-params`, creates a POST route, shows how to access query parameters.
- `node-express-middleware-logger`, creates an example middleware
- `node-express-middleware-error`, creates an error handling middleware
- `node-http-server`, creates a simple HTTP server
- `node-file-read-sync`, reads a file synchronously
- `node-file-read-async`, reads a file asynchronously, with a callback
- `node-event-emitter`, creates an event emitter, emit events and shows to subscribe to said event
- `node-promise-create`, creates a Promise
- `node-promise-shorthand`, creates a Promises using the static methods `resolve()` and `reject()`
- `node-promise-all`, resolves a list of Promises using the `Promise.all([])` method
- `node-async-await`, using async/await
- `node-express-schema-validation`, adding schema validation for express, read more about the usage of schema validation with `Joi` at https://github.com/hapijs/joi
- `node-regex-test-digits`, invokes the `test()` method that tests whether a string matches a regular expression on digits.
- `node-regex-test-word`, invokes the `test()` method that tests whether a string matches a regular expression on word boundaries.
- `node-regex-match`, invokes the method `match()` on a regular expression to find a file extension
- `node-regex-match-named-group`, invokes the method `match()` on a regular expression and place it in a group called `exteension`.
- `node-http-quark`, creates a HTTP app using the framework [quarkhttp](https://www.npmjs.com/package/quarkhttp),
- `node-http-quark-get`, adds a GET route to your [quarkhttp](https://www.npmjs.com/package/quarkhttp) app
- `node-http-quark-post`, adds a POST route to your [quarkhttp](https://www.npmjs.com/package/quarkhttp) app
- `node-http-quark-put`, adds a PUT route to your [quarkhttp](https://www.npmjs.com/package/quarkhttp) app
- `node-http-quark-middleware`, adds a middleware to your [quarkhttp](https://www.npmjs.com/package/quarkhttp) app
- `node-jest-suite`, adds a test suite
- `node-jest-test`, adds a test
- `node-jest-test-expect`, adds a test with an expect
- `node-jest-expect`, adds an expect, using `toBe()`
- `node-jest-expect-to-equal`, adds expect, using `toEqual()`
- `node-jest-test-expect-to-equal`, adds a test with an expect, using `toEqual()`
- `node-jest-expect-to-throw`, adds an expect, using `toThrow()`
- `node-jest-test-expect-to-throw`, adds a test with an expect, using `toThrow()`,
- `node-jest-test-beforeAll`, adds a `beforeAll()`, this method runs before all tests
- `node-jest-test-afterAll`, adds a `afterAll()`, this method runs after all tests
- `node-supertest-init`, adds the initial imports for supertest and the app you are about to test. I assume the app you are about to test looks something like this:

```javascript
// app.js
const express = require('express')
const app = express();
// your route definitions
module.exports = app;
```

and that your file structure looks like this:

```bash
-| app.js // this is where the web app goes
-| __tests__/
---| app.js // this where the tests goes
```

- `node-supertest-beforeall`, configures supertest to use the app instance, this is a needed step to initialize supertest
- `node-supertest-aftereall`, ensures the web app closes down after the test run, this is a needed step.
- `node-supertest-testget`, an example of supertest testing a GET route
- `node-supertest-testgetwithparam`, an example of supertest testing a GET route with a route parameter
- `node-supertest-testpost`, an example of supertest testing a POST route with a payload
